Unlocking Power: Dive into Hafthor Björnsson’s 8,000-Calorie Diet Strategy

Muscular man smiling in a bathroom, 8,000-Calorie Diet Hafthor Björnsson


Fueling Strength: An Inside Look at Hafthor Björnsson's 8,000-Calorie Diet

Hafthor Björnsson, the behemoth known to many as "The Mountain," is more than just a towering figure in the world of strength sports; he’s the current deadlift world record holder, thanks in no small part to his meticulously curated nutrition plan. Aiming to fuel not only his body but also his ambition to break his own records, Björnsson adheres to an astonishing 8,000-calorie diet packed with over 400 grams of protein each day.

The Mechanics of Massive Eating

To sustain such colossal muscle mass, Björnsson starts his day with hydrating electrolytes mixed into his morning routine, ensuring he has the energy needed for his demanding workouts. Each of his five meals is strategically planned to coincide with his intense training schedule, showing how important timing can be in muscle-building endeavors. "I used to eat 10,000 calories daily when I was younger and more active, but now I find 8,000 is perfect for my current needs," he quips.

Details of Each Meal

The first meal of the day exemplifies bodybuilding meals, including:

  • 300 grams of mixed potatoes and sweet potatoes

  • 100 grams of rice, which are crucial for carbohydrate intake

  • Four large eggs, one of the best sources of protein

  • 200 grams of Greek yogurt with olive oil for additional calories

This first mean is a powerhouse, clocking in at around 1,640 calories, laden with nutrients that facilitate recovery and performance.

Gaining Insights from a Strongman’s Diet

According to experts like Dr. Mike Israetel, adding caloric-dense liquids can significantly ease the burden of consuming such a high calorie count. Meals two and three mimic each other, incorporating ribeye steak, more rice, and essential fats from avocados, rounding out the caloric intake while still focusing on nutritious foods. For example, meal two includes:

  • 150 grams of beef tenderloin

  • 300 grams of rice

Ways This Diet Impacts Performance

This structured meal plan not only fuels Björnsson's extraordinary physical demands but also supports his mental focus. By not overthinking his meals and approaching eating like a task, he manages to maintain consistency and manage his appetite effectively. Björnsson exemplifies the idea that nutrition can become part of a larger strategy for achieving athletic goals.
